FaceTime on macbook pro retina with Mavericks

I have just bought a 15" macbook pro retina with Mavericks and FaceTime has never worked. My account works fine on my iPad and iPhone but macbook version just won't connect and says 'FaceTime call failed. Can anyone help?

The following Knowledge Base article offers up a few good steps for troubleshooting FaceTime on your Mac:


FaceTime for Mac: Troubleshooting FaceTime

http://support.apple.com/kb/ts4185


If you encounter issues making or receiving FaceTime calls, try the following:

  • Verify that FaceTime is enabled in FaceTime > Preferences.

    If the issue persists, or if you see the message "Waiting for Activation", try toggling FaceTime off and then on.

  • Verify that the Date, Time, and Time Zone are set correctly:
    1. From the Apple () menu, choose System Preferences > Date & Time > Date & Time.
    2. Enable "Set Automatically".
    3. Click the Time Zone tab and confirm the closest city is correct.
  • Verify that both parties are connected to an active broadband Internet connection.
  • Verify the phone number or email address being used is the correct one activated for FaceTime.

    You can verify that you are using a valid Apple ID at appleid.apple.com. You can also create an Apple ID or reset your password from this website.
